Traffic up at Chicago Carless, BIN 36 web sites MCO falls to fifth place 6-Feb-10 – 14 web sites with a Marina City connection have entered the new year with estimated traffic rankings shuffled slightly from last fall. skyscrapercity.com, operated by Marina City resident Jan Klerks, and hotelsaxchicago.com held onto the first and second spots. However, marinacityonline.com fell from third to fifth place.
According to the web analysis company Alexa, which bases traffic estimates on data collected from users of its toolbar and other sources over three months, there were about the same number of unique visitors to skyscrapercity.com but traffic was down significantly at the Hotel Sax site. Although still ranked second, it went from the 650,985th most popular web site to 1,325,569th. The most dramatic increase was at marina-city.com, the web site of Marina Management Company, a real estate brokerage firm. Redesigned recently, the site went from a rank of almost 14 million to 3.2 million, which would put it in the top two percent of all web sites. Brian Muir, president of Marina Management Company, says the redesigned site has been received well by clients and prospective tenants. “It has been key in our renting out a number of Marina City apartments and drumming up buyer interest during a normally slow season.”
The Hotel Sax web site was also redesigned recently, after Thompson Hotel Associates was hired in December to manage the hotel. New on the list is MAS Context, a quarterly journal of urban issues edited by Marina City resident Iker Gill. marinacitychicagogiftshopgallery.com and landmarkmarinacitynow.org did not have enough traffic to be ranked by Alexa. They did have enough traffic three months ago to be ranked in the last two spots. The web site of Marina Towers Condominium Association, mymtca.com, surfaced, taking a spot in 11th place. Draper & Kramer’s web site, dkcondo.com, which serves 82 associations including Marina Towers, had an Alexa rank of 4,219,311, down from 2,246,810 three months ago. Because they are sub-domains, Alexa cannot rank chicago.dickslastresort.com, chicago.transwestern.net, or marinawatchdog.blogspot.com. Marina City Online recently built an improved portal to Marina Watchdog, the blog for Marina City residents. From January 13 to February 5, according to Google Analytics, the portal was used 392 times by 260 unique visitors. Meanwhile, Google calculated 4,269 visits to Marina City Online in January, down from 4,781 in December. According to the Internet services company Netcraft, there were 206 million web sites in January 2010. The top three sites, according to Alexa, are currently google.com, facebook.com, and yahoo.com. |
